Function and features of black screen protective film
The main features of this privacy screen protector include;
- Privacy protection: The primary function of a black screen protective film is to safeguard an individual's privacy. It prevents onlookers from peering into the device by effectively blocking visibility from acute angles.
- Glare reduction: These films help minimize glare from bright lights or sunlight. Consequently, they enhance screen visibility, especially for outdoor use.
- Scratch resistance: They possess scratch-resistant abilities that enable them to withstand scratches from keys, cables, and other rough materials. The protective films are made explicitly to guard against scratches and, in so doing, preserve the screen's clarity and quality. They may also feature self-healing properties that allow minor scratches to become less noticeable over time.
- Easy installation: Users are provided with ease of installation, which is made possible by the inclusion of installation tools, guidelines, and a bubble-free adhesive that makes the application of the protective film simple and easy. Also, black screen protective films come in multiple sizes, making it simple for users to choose the one compatible with their devices.
- Anti-glare and anti-smudge: Such films reduce glare from bright light, improving visibility. They also feature a matte finish that minimizes glare, making them suitable for use in bright environments or outdoors. Additionally, smudge and fingerprint resistance is a key feature of black screen protective films. The screen savers resist smudges and fingerprints, thereby keeping the screen clean and improving visual clarity.
- Custom fit: These black screen protective films offer a custom fit. They are available in various shapes and sizes corresponding to each device's make and model. Additionally, black screen protective films are compatible with cases because they are designed to work with device cases without lifting edges or interfering with the fit.
- Touchscreen compatibility: This feature enables the protective film to work seamlessly with touchscreens, ensuring no decrease in sensitivity or responsiveness.

Q&A
Q: Does the black screen protective film stop the fingerprint scanner from working?
A: Some varieties of black screen protective films may interfere with the performance of in-display fingerprint scanners. However, engineered anti-fingerprint film varieties are available in the market that are specifically designed to be compatible with these scanners. They feature advanced surface textures that allow for accurate fingerprint recognition without compromising the protective function of the film. To ensure optimal compatibility, it is advisable to check the manufacturer's guidelines or product specifications to confirm compatibility with the specific device's fingerprint scanner technology.
Q: How to clean bubbles or dust from the inside after applying the protective film?
A: If bubbles or dust particles become trapped beneath the surface of a protective film, there is no need for concern or panic. These minor imperfections can be easily rectified and removed. To tackle air bubbles, gently press down on the bubble with a soft cloth or fingernail to push it towards the edge of the film for seamless removal. In the case of dust particles, carefully lift a corner of the protective film with a plastic card or similar tool. This action will create enough space to remove the dust particle using either your finger or tweezers. Finally, smoothly reapply the film, ensuring a bubble-free and dust-free installation.
